Autonomous Navigation (25%): Professionals skilled in developing and managing autonomous navigation systems are in high demand. This skill empowers SAR robots to navigate challenging terrains and reach victims in hard-to-reach locations. 2. Object Detection (20%): Object detection is another crucial skill, as it enables robots to identify and locate victims efficiently. This technology is particularly valuable in low-visibility environments, such as dark caves or disaster-stricken areas. 3. Data Analysis (15%): With the increasing reliance on data-driven decision-making, professionals skilled in data analysis are essential to the SAR robotics field. These experts interpret data from various sensors and systems to optimize search patterns and improve response times. 4. Machine Learning (18%): Machine learning algorithms help SAR robots adapt to new situations, enhancing their ability to perform complex tasks. As a result, professionals with machine learning expertise are highly sought after in the SAR robotics job market. 5. Communication Systems (22%): Robust communication systems are vital for coordinating search and rescue missions. Professionals with expertise in this area ensure seamless communication between robots, operators, and emergency responders, contributing to successful missions.
